I keep the record of the surviving 190As for the Victoria Association. There was no 1930 190A model. The production 190A was introduced in November of 1930, and it was the first Model A to have 1931 features such as the slant windshield and the 2-panel radiator shell.
It appears that the changeover to the Steel-Back started at various Ford branch assembly plants about February, 1931. It is likely that not all Ford assembly plants made the changeover to the Steel Back at the same time. To support the Ford assembly plants, the Murray Corporation would have made the production changeover from the Leather-Back to the Steel-Back several months earlier, but the specific date of the changeover by the Murray Corporation is unknown.
